When an employee works by hours, the Department of Labor of the United States considers that that employee must be paid overtime when he works more than 40 hours a week. The federal government considers overtime when the employee surpasses that amount of hours in a week of work. By law, that worker must be paid one and a half times its regular rate per hour.
